Are light novels and manga the same?
Definitely not. Light novels focus more on detailed prose and character development through written descriptions. Manga, on the other hand, relies heavily on visual art to convey the story. They have distinct artistic and narrative approaches.

Are manga and light novels the same?
No, they aren't. Manga is mostly visual with illustrations and text, while light novels focus more on text with some illustrations.
